Output 23a9710891839df73ccd976b16ad53fa9e59d34323ae4ddc25be0c69d903714e:1

value
18705428
script pubkey
OP_0 OP_PUSHBYTES_20 afcecedba478dc518cab3fec2fa4d0961006cee6
address
ltc1q4l8vakay0rw9rr9t8lkzlfxsjcgqdnhx9dpy03
transaction
23a9710891839df73ccd976b16ad53fa9e59d34323ae4ddc25be0c69d903714e
spent
true